☐ Shuttle-bus gate walkthrough. Take your new starter out to the Appledore Lane gate and show them where the Kestwick shuttle pulls in — it's easy to miss behind the bike shed. Mention the shuttle won't wait past two minutes, so no dawdling. The gate locks automatically after each opening, which surprises people. Walk them through punching in the access code, which is below.

staff pass of kawip-hawef = bdg-QLP-2

Q3 Planning Note — Cash-Flow Forecast (Sales Leads Only)

Our Q3 forecast for the Marlowe & Tate portfolio assumes collections improve to a 42-day average, down from 51 in Q2. Receivables from the Brindlehaven accounts remain the largest risk; please flag any payment-term renegotiations before committing them. Outflows are front-loaded in July due to the Caldera tooling deposit, so discretionary spend approvals will tighten through August. Review your pipeline assumptions carefully against these figures before Friday's session.

board note of fahag-tajop: The eastern region missed its Julix quota by 44.0 percent last quarter. Ralionax Holdings plans to lower the Druath list price by 61.8 percent in March. The board signed off on a budget of $295.0 million for Project Gilath. The renewal with Ruswynix Systems closes at $274.5 million a year, 17.0 percent above the last contract.

## Tax-Rate Lookup Cache

The Copperdale service caches jurisdiction tax rates in an in-memory LRU with a 24-hour TTL, refreshed nightly from the Marleyfort rates feed. Never bypass the cache in request paths; stale entries are acceptable per finance policy. Manual invalidation requires a change ticket. For cache questions or invalidation requests, write to the address below.

escalation mailbox, hafop-fahop: ralix_oliael@qirvanlabs.internal